Ticket: InkLedger PDF renderer vault locked. The signing vault for the invoice renderer sealed itself after three failed unlock attempts during last night's deploy at Quartzbay. Rendering jobs are queued but unsigned PDFs cannot ship. Reviewer: please confirm the unlock flow in the attached diff before we proceed. The recovery passphrase for the vault is as follows.

unlock words, hafop-tahog: drumir-druiel-kasox-wenax-tamys-frair

Action item from the Mirewater tide-table widget incident. Owner: release manager. Widget cached stale harbor offsets after the DST change, showing tides six hours off for two days. Required: add a cache-invalidation check to the release checklist, block deploys when offset tables are older than 24 hours, and verify the Saltgate harbor feed before each cut. Deadline: next release. Checklist template and sign-off procedure are documented on the internal page below.

wiki page, kawif-bajep: https://artifactory.zarqelforge.internal/issue/browse/display/display/projects/spaces/secrets/000fe6ec5a46af29355003e1

## v4.2.0 — Broker upgrade

We finally bumped Quillway's message broker from Larkmq 2.x to 3.1. The big win for you folks: TLS is now enforced on all inter-node links, and the legacy plaintext listener is gone for good. Auth moved to scoped tokens with 24h expiry. Rollback plan is documented in the ops runbook. Any security questions about the migration should go to the engineer who owned it.

account owner for bawip-tahag: Raleth Quenok